Laura Ashley has officially gone into administration after 52 years as a firm favourite for fashion and homeware lovers.The British textile design company, which was first founded by Bernard Ashley, an engineer, and his wife Laura Ashley in 1953, opened its first shop in 1968 on Pelham Street, South Kensington in London with additional shops then opening in Shrewsbury and Bath in 1970. Laura Ashley then grew over the next 20 years to become a hugely popular international retail chain.
